What buyers should know before shortlisting Intervy
Intervy is a powerful platform designed to enhance remote team engagement and training. By integrating seamlessly with Microsoft Teams, it allows for easy adoption and effective interaction among employees.
The platform fosters collaboration, ensures ongoing employee training, and boosts overall productivity. While its focus on Microsoft Teams is a strength, teams using different tools may find it less compatible.
Additionally, while it excels at remote engagement, broader learning needs might require additional resources. Overall, Intervy is a solid choice for companies looking to optimize remote work and employee training with a user-friendly, engaging solution.

Intervy reviews and ratings
What buyers like
- The platform is specifically designed to optimize the remote work experience, offering features that cater to the needs of dispersed teams.
- By facilitating employee connections, Intervy helps strengthen collaboration and communication within remote teams, boosting productivity.
- Intervy makes employee training more accessible and engaging, helping organizations ensure continuous learning, even in remote setups.
Common complaints
- Since Intervy is built around Microsoft Teams, it may not be ideal for teams using other collaboration tools.
- The platform primarily focuses on remote interaction and training, which might not cater to broader learning and development needs.
- Teams unfamiliar with Microsoft Teams or virtual learning tools may face a bit of a learning curve when adapting to the platform.
